On August 16 in Honolulu, join sake enthusiasts for a showcase of an extensive line of premium sake styles in the Junmai, Ginjo, Daiginjo and Kimoto categories, many of which are not otherwise available in the U.S. Restaurants from Banzai Sushi Bar to pop-up The Pig and The Lady, and even Top Chef’s Sheldon Simeon will be providing bites to go with all of the amazing spirits.
The event is actually the public tasting that follows the U.S. National Sake Appraisal; over a two-day period, a team of five judges from Japan and five from the U.S. will evaluate aroma, taste, balance and overall harmony in each entry. After all sakes are judged and awarded, the public is allowed to taste the entries – last year, there were 360 entries from 171 breweries and from 39 different prefectures.
And if you’re not lucky enough to enjoy all the amazing sake in Honolulu, the next stop will be on September 26th in New York City before they return to Tokyo.
